進階電子表格自動格式化

進階電子表格自動格式化

是否可以像這樣自動設定電子表格格式

如果 A1 = C1,則 A1:E1 細胞背景變為淺灰色

我使用 OO Calc,但如果您知道如何在 MS Excel 或 Google 試算表中執行此操作,那就沒問題了

答案1

在 OOo 和 Excel 中,只需將列的絕對引用與行的相對引用組合起來即可。這樣,您可以將條件格式複製到每個儲存格,它將評估目前行中儲存格 A 和 C 的值。

在 OOo 中,您必須如下定義條件格式:

  1. 選擇第 1 行中應設定條件格式的儲存格,然後Conditional Formatting...從選單「 」中選擇「 」Format
  2. 使用公式定義條件格式$A1=$C1。如果您選擇了第 1 行中的儲存格,則此選項有效。2, 使用$A2=$C2。這$定義一個絕對參考如果將格式複製到其他儲存格,則不會變更。如果$缺少,則引用為相對的(將其貼到另一個單元格時它將發生變化)。因此,如果將引用 $A1 從第一行複製到第二行,它將指向 $A2。 條件格式
  3. 複製儲存格,選擇其他需要條件格式化的儲存格,然後選擇選單“ ” Edit-> “ Paste special”或CTRL++ ;SHIFTV
  4. 在「Paste Special」對話方塊的「Selection」選項中,取消選擇「Formats」以外的所有內容。 特殊貼上

結果,為步驟 3 中選取的每個儲存格定義了條件格式,其中公式指向目前行的儲存格 A 和 C。

答案2

您應該能夠透過 Excel 中的條件格式來做到這一點,我不確定其他的。具體方法取決於Excel的版本。

編輯:這應該是你需要的,但我沒有 2007 年來測試它

在 Excel 2007 中:選擇範圍

在功能區上,轉到“主頁”選項卡,然後按“條件格式”

點選新建規則

按一下“使用公式確定要設定格式的儲存格”

對於公式,輸入 =A1=A3

點選格式按鈕。

選擇與儲存格顏色相符的字體顏色。

點選確定,點選確定

相關內容